Synchronous Ethernet Frequency Translator ICS840272I DATA SHEET General Description The ICS840272I is a PLL-based Frequency Translator intended for use in Synchronous Ethernet applications. This high performance device is optimized to generate 25MHz and 8kHz LVCMOS clock outputs. The ICS840272I accepts the following differential or single-ended input signals: 161.1328125MHz (10GbE Mode), 156.25MHz (1GbE Mode), or 125MHz (Recovered clock from 10/100/1000BaseT Ethernet PHY). The extended temperature range supports telecommunication and networking end equipment requirements. ICS840272I Data Sheet SYNCHRONOUS ETHERNET FREQUENCY TRANSLATOR Parameter Measurement Information 1.65V±5% 1.65V±5% VDD VDD, VDDO VDDA SCOPE nCLK[0:1] LVCMOS GND Qx CLK[0:1] V PP Cross Points V CMR GND -1.65V±5% LVCMOS Output Load AC Test Circuit Differential Input Level V QA, QB DDO 2 80% 20% tR 80% 20% tF t PW t PERIOD QA, QB odc = t PW t PERIOD x 100% Output Duty Cycle/Pulse Width/Period Output Rise/Fall Time Phase Noise Plot Noise Power V QA, QB DDORx V DDORx V DDORx 2 t cycle n 2 2 t cycle n+1 ➤ t jit(cc) = |t cycle n – t cycle n+1| 1000 Cycles f1 Offset Frequency f2 RMS Jitter = Area Under Curve Defined by the Offset Frequency Markers RMS Phase Jitter Cycle-to-Cycle Jitter ICS840272AGI REVISION A JULY 26, 2010 7 ©2010 Integrated Device Technology, Inc. ➤ ➤ ➤ ICS840272I Data Sheet SYNCHRONOUS ETHERNET FREQUENCY TRANSLATOR Applications Information Power Supply Filtering Technique As in any high speed analog circuitry, the power supply pins are vulnerable to random noise. To achieve optimum jitter performance, power supply isolation is required. The ICS840272I provides separate power supplies to isolate any high switching noise from the outputs to the internal PLL. VDD, VDDA and VDDO should be individually connected to the power supply plane through vias, and 0.01µF bypass capacitors should be used for each pin. Figure 1 illustrates this for a generic VDD pin and also shows that VDDA requires that an additional 10Ω resistor along with a 10µF bypass capacitor be connected to the VDDA pin. 3.3V VDD .01µF VDDA .01µF 10µF 10Ω Figure 1. Power Supply Filtering Recommendations for Unused Input and Output Pins Inputs: LVCMOS Control Pins All control pins have internal pullups or pulldowns; additional resistance is not required but can be added for additional protection. A 1kΩ resistor can be used. CLK/nCLK Inputs For applications not requiring the use of the differential input, both CLK and nCLK can be left floating. Though not required, but for additional protection, a 1kΩ resistor can be tied from CLK to ground. Outputs: LVCMOS Outputs All unused LVCMOS output can be left floating. ICS840272I Data Sheet SYNCHRONOUS ETHERNET FREQUENCY TRANSLATOR Wiring the Differential Input to Accept Single-Ended Levels Figure 2 shows how a differential input can be wired to accept single ended levels. The reference voltage VREF = VDD/2 is generated by the bias resistors R1 and R2. The bypass capacitor (C1) is used to help filter noise on the DC bias. This bias circuit should be located as close to the input pin as possible. The ratio of R1 and R2 might need to be adjusted to position the VREF in the center of the input voltage swing. For example, if the input clock swing is 2.5V and VDD = 3.3V, R1 and R2 value should be adjusted to set VREF at 1.25V. The values below are for when both the single ended swing and VDD are at the same voltage. This configuration requires that the sum of the output impedance of the driver (Ro) and the series resistance (Rs) equals the transmission line impedance. In addition, matched termination at the input will attenuate the signal in half. This can be done in one of two ways. First, R3 and R4 in parallel should equal the transmission line impedance. For most 50Ω applications, R3 and R4 can be 100Ω. The values of the resistors can be increased to reduce the loading for slower and weaker LVCMOS driver. When using single-ended signaling, the noise rejection benefits of differential signaling are reduced. Even though the differential input can handle full rail LVCMOS signaling, it is recommended that the amplitude be reduced. The datasheet specifies a lower differential amplitude, however this only applies to differential signals. For single-ended applications, the swing can be larger, however VIL cannot be less than -0.3V and VIH cannot be more than VDD + 0.3V. Though some of the recommended components might not be used, the pads should be placed in the layout. They can be utilized for debugging purposes. The datasheet specifications are characterized and guaranteed by using a differential signal. Figure 2. ICS840272I Data Sheet SYNCHRONOUS ETHERNET FREQUENCY TRANSLATOR Power Considerations This section provides information on power dissipation and junction temperature for the ICS840272I. Equations and example calculations are also provided. 1. Power Dissipation. The total power dissipation for the ICS840272I is the sum of the core power plus the analog power plus the power dissipated in the load(s). The following is the power dissipation for VDD = 3.3V + 5% = 3.465V, which gives worst case results. • • Power (core)MAX = VDD_MAX * (IDD + IDDA+ IDDO) = 3.465V *(57mA + 11mA + 5mA) = 252.9mW Output Impedance ROUT Power Dissipation due to Loading 50Ω to VDD/2 Output Current IOUT = VDD_MAX / [2 * (50Ω + ROUT)] = 3.465V / [2 * (50Ω + 17Ω)] = 25.86mA Total Power Dissipation on the ROUT per LVCMOS output Power (ROUT) = ROUT * (IOUT)2 = 17Ω * (25.86mA)2 = 11.4mW per output Total Power (ROUT) = 11.4mW * 2 = 22.8mW • Total Power Dissipation • Total Power = Power (core)MAX + Total Power (ROUT) = 252.9mW + 22.8mW = 275.7mW 2. Junction Temperature. Junction temperature, Tj, is the temperature at the junction of the bond wire and bond pad directly affects the reliability of the device. The maximum recommended junction temperature is 125°C. Limiting the internal transistor junction temperature, Tj, to 125°C ensures that the bond wire and bond pad temperature remains below 125°C. The equation for Tj is as follows: Tj = θJA * Pd_total + TA Tj = Junction Temperature θJA = Junction-to-Ambient Thermal Resistance Pd_total = Total Device Power Dissipation (example calculation is in section 1 above) TA = Ambient Temperature In order to calculate junction temperature, the appropriate junction-to-ambient thermal resistance θJA must be used. Assuming no air flow and a multi-layer board, the appropriate value is 81.2°C/W per Table 6 below. Therefore, Tj for an ambient temperature of 85°C with all outputs switching is: 85°C + 0.276W *81.2°C/W = 107.4°C. This is below the limit of 125°C. This calculation is only an example. Tj will obviously vary depending on the number of loaded outputs, supply voltage, air flow and the type of board (multi-layer). Table 6.
